Output c668ea32cdc2615198ca02e30b5f8c19b9ce6b5940e95397ecac9535e2031b17:0

value
17487369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b54a5ab02bc9d9d42652e0df8e76cfd270139c4 OP_EQUAL
address
MQyfzgumkGx2kDD1ig27cN9DZ6JH4MyBpN
transaction
c668ea32cdc2615198ca02e30b5f8c19b9ce6b5940e95397ecac9535e2031b17
spent
true